  1. Responsibilities. Judas was in charge of the group's money (John 13:29) and was a thief who regularly stole from it (John 12:6). He was known to be a liar (John 12:3 - 6) who was also deceitful and greedy (Matthew 26:14 - 15). He was called a traitor (Luke 6:16) and was identified as a betrayer during the last Passover (John 13:21 - 26).

  6. Judas Iscariot, (died c. 30 ce ), Disciple who betrayed Jesus. Judas was one of the original Twelve Apostles. He made a deal with the Jewish authorities to betray Jesus into their custody: in return for 30 pieces of silver, Judas brought an armed guard to the Garden of Gethsemane and identified Jesus with a kiss.
